....Statutory composition of the Adjudicating Authority requires a legally constituted Bench; absent an evidence-based finding that a Chairperson-only Bench was validly constituted, its adjudication is coram non judice and a nullity. The authority must identify the relevant property and record a prima facie finding that it is involved in money-laundering; a need to retain or freeze property for adjudication cannot replace that finding. Bank accounts or business turnover alone are not proceeds of crime without a reasoned nexus to scheduled-offence criminal activity. An appellate body cannot supply this omitted foundational finding. Non-communication of reasons to believe also breaches statutory safeguards, vitiating freezing and retention proceedings. The impugned order was quashed without deciding whether any offence was committed.....
